The following sections describe the twisted pair and fiber optic port LEDs.
A twisted pair port has two LEDs labeled L/A (link/activity) and D/C (duplex
mode/collisions). The L/A LED indicates the speed and activity on a port.
The D/C LED indicates the duplex mode (full- or half-duplex) and the
status of collisions on the port.
Table 3 describes the LEDs for the 10/100/1000Base-T twisted pair ports.
